DeSantis awards $18M to help boost state’s aggregate supply chain

Published September 21, 2024 7:19am ET



(The Center Square) – Florida Gov. Ron DeSantis awarded $18 million as the first of $100 million in the next five years to boost the state’s supply chain and aggregate storage.

State officials say the first five grant recipients will create an additional 1.2 million tons of aggregate materials storage and enable more rail access to existing storage facilities. These materials are used in construction and can include sand, gravel, crushed stone and recycled concrete.
